To find the technical boring answer :

http://ons.gov.uk/ons/rel/cpi/consumer-price-indices/june-2015/stb-cpi-june-2015.html#tab-Retail-Prices-Index--RPI--and-RPIJ (http://ons.gov.uk/ons/rel/cpi/consumer-price-indices/june-2015/stb-cpi-june-2015.html#tab-Retail-Prices-Index--RPI--and-RPIJ)

Jan 2014 the RPI index was 252.6
June 2015 it was 258.9

Which I think makes 2.5% but Jan and Feb were weird months as it went -0.3% then +0.6% for each of those months.

Then of course there is the difference between RPI, RPIJ, RPIX, CPI etc.   ;sleep;
